Trump puts global growth on notice, OCR to fall further

Donald Trump's trade tariffs could change the economic landscape in the near-term, economists say.

WATCH: Rabobank Senior market strategist Ben Picton speaks with Jonathan Mitchell.

US President Donald Trump’s trade tariffs are likely to put the squeeze on global economic growth prospects, but unlikely to deter the RBNZ from further rate cuts.
